So, 'Deathgasm 2: Goremageddon' takes that wild, irreverent vibe from the first film and cranks it up. Brodie's antics after trying to resurrect his old bandmates really highlight the absurdity of chasing after glory and love through chaos. It’s got that raw, DIY aesthetic—lots of practical effects that scream low-budget charm, which I appreciate. The humor is dark and twisted, but there’s also that underlying sense of camaraderie among the characters, even when they’re tearing each other apart. The pacing feels snappy, keeping you on your toes. It's this blend of horror and comedy that might not be for everyone, but if you're into this kind of madness, it definitely carves out its own niche. Feels like a good time at a late-night screening.
